imort 박뉴프

이상현상(Anomaly) 본문

Develop/Database

이상현상(Anomaly)

박뉴프 2022. 8. 25. 21:04

2022년 7월 3일

이상현상(Anomaly)

 

데이터베이스 이상현상이란 데이터의 불필요한 중복으로 테이블 조작시 발생하는 데이터 불일치 현상이다.

 

삽입이상

 

-데이터 삽입시, 불필요한 데이터까지 삽입해야 하는 현상.

 

갱신이상

 

-데이터 수정 시, 동일한 데이터가 중복 저장되어 전부 수정하지 않으면 불일치가 발생하는 이상 현상.

 

삭제이상

 

-데이터 삭제 시, 필요한 다른 데이터까지 삭제되는 이상현상.

 

위의 이상현상들은 정규화를 통해 해결할 수 있다.

 

 

 


🔍 블로그 https://parkmj236.tistory.com

🔍 Notion 이력서 https://branch-frog-b20.notion.site/Park-Minji-e4fa8aa44b8c48b582a9082515dbc15e

🔍 Github https://github.com/Park-New-project/Projects


참고

https://parkmj236.tistory.com/14

 

정규화(Normalization)

정규화 데이터베이스 중복성을 최소화해서 이상현상을 방지하는 것이다. 정규화의 장점 데이터베이스 변경시 이상현상을 제거할 수 있다. 새로운 데이터형 추가시 구조를 바꾸지 않거나 일부

parkmj236.tistory.com

https://parkmj236.tistory.com/19

 

NoSQL(No Only SQL)

RDBMS SQL에 의해 저장, 수정, 삭제된다. 정해진 스키마를 따른다. 외래 키를 이용해 관계를 나타내고 테이블간 Join 한다. *DBMS : 사용자의 요구에 따라 정보를 생성하고 데이터베이스를 관리해주는

parkmj236.tistory.com

'Develop > Database' 카테고리의 다른 글

데이터 사전  (0) 2022.10.03
반정규화 (Denormalization)  (0) 2022.08.31
무결성 제약조건  (0) 2022.08.28
NoSQL(No Only SQL)  (0) 2022.08.21
정규화(Normalization)  (0) 2022.08.14
Comments